About Heng Chhay
Heng Chhay is a scholar working on Virology, Immunology and Allergy and Physiology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 370 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Asthma and respiratory diseases (4 papers), HIV Research and Treatment (2 papers) and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Virology (69 citations), Physiology (207 citations) and Immunology and Allergy (47 citations). Heng Chhay has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Joshua A. Boyce, Tanya M. Laidlaw, Ginger L. Milne, Wei Xing, Neil Bhattacharyya, Shiliang Shen, Mariana Castells, Joyce Steinberg, Ann A. Kiessling and Randal A. Byrn. Their work appears in journals such as Blood, Nature Biotechnology and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ology.
